I posted this in another thread but here goes...

I am right handed and on an iPhone.

My left thumb is solely for dodging left and my right index finger is for everything else. So basically my left thumb just sits a hair above the left dodge icon. My right index finger is fast enough to cover everything else.

Also, I only use my shield against the God King when he goes into his 'super attack' mode cause I have trouble dodging or parrying all his attacks, so I save my shield power until it comes.

Hope this helps.

Keep on trying to master the parry. I would even recommend resarting from bloodline 1 if needed so you can get the hang of it.

Parrying is worth its weight in gold. Many times after parrying an enemy's final attack swing, a parry will give you a longer period of time to deliver your attacks.

Agreed. Dodging requires longer time to recover and leaves you with lesser time to strike. But because the enemy's final strike is usually very slow and telegraphic, you can dodge early and by the time you return to the original position, the swing will be right in your face but you are still considered to have dodged the attack. Doing so should leave you with enough time to perform a mega combo.
